So, I signed up for the CBS Sports Parlay Pick em contest at the beginning of the year. You pick one NFL parlay per week against the odds, anywhere from 2 to all of the games. Figured I try some 3-4 team parlays and see how I do. Actually hit a 3 teamer in week 1 and a 5 teamer this week, so not bad overall.
Well, that puts me light years behind the leaders:
Week 1: some guy hits a 16 for 16 parlay. Missed out on claiming the $100,000 prize for a perfect 16 for 16 parlay card because he didn't hit all 3 of the extra 'bonus' picks correct. (Pretty cheap, Yahoo--if someone goes 16 for 16, you ought to pony up). However,
Over the course of the season, there have been 19 parlays of 10 teams or more. Six have gone 14 for 14; 4 have gone 13 for 13. Just this week, four went 14 for 14 and 2 went 13 for 13 (didn't make a selection on last night's game).
I realize there's a random possibility where someone can go on a website and just click on the right selection in that many games, but I'm just blown away there have been that many. And I don't think it's like there are millions of entries going through each week. Prior to this week with my measly 12 points, I was like 1,200th in the standings.
And if any of these 19 live in a state that allows sports betting, what kind of payday could they have collected (or are they kicking themselves for forgoing). A $10 bet would be some life changing money on a 13 to 14 team parlay, assuming you can even do those.
